Transaction dd7d9f34c151720e844ef2cdd87fe094f7b3ae8ba783646d11bb207f31a44181
1 Input
2 Outputs
- dd7d9f34c151720e844ef2cdd87fe094f7b3ae8ba783646d11bb207f31a44181:0
- dd7d9f34c151720e844ef2cdd87fe094f7b3ae8ba783646d11bb207f31a44181:1
value 3186697
address 3MFuSmr3N7G6VBEorb9ouwWofC3JhqQfcW
value 112712294
address 1PZE3QQXcxi2paTnJBufL2kGfdSTPsJvbe